I am sorry. The nurse should have been more sympathetic when explaining the time frame to you. I am sure she is well aware of the hoops that must be jumped through to get this approval and the emotional rollercoaster people are on. I am not sure what plan you have, but if you don't want more delays and you are confident in your surgeon, I would probably just stick it out. AniO had a great suggestion to contact the scheduler and see if there is a wait list, my doctor's nurse told me that often patients will back out just days before their surgery. That being said, if they do have one you should absolutely stick firmly to your preop diet in case you got called ahead of time (makes the liver less fatty, they have to lift it to get to your stomach).
